accept to say yes when someone wants to give you something.
card a small, thick piece of paper used for sending a message to another person.
hang to attach to a point without support from below.
lay1 to put something down so that it is flat against a surface.
lazy not wanting to work or use effort.
loaf a single quantity of bread the way it is just after it is baked and before it is cut into slices.
musician a person who has skill at playing, singing, or writing music.
pavement the hard surface on a road or other flat area.
plan an action one intends to take; aim.
plank a length of wood thicker than a board.
spot a mark that is different in color from the area around it.
terrible causing fear, terror, or horror.
tonight the present night or the night that is coming on this day.
travel to go from place to place.
wave the water that rises from the surface of a body of water.
